Jewels of Java honors fallen Marine
-- Casual Living, 9/28/2009 9:38:00 AM
Jewels of Java recently participated in a Memorial Golf Tournament in Central Square, N.Y.
The tournament was held Sept. 6 in memory of Marine Capt. Phil Dykeman, who was killed in Iraq on June 26, 2008. Dykeman had been a good friend of Brent Crane, a Jewels of Java sales representative. Crane and his daughter also have trained for the past year to run the Marine Corps Marathon in Dykeman’s memory.
|
The Jewels of Java team included, Shipping and Service Manager Jim Santacrose, left, Eli Simeon, Karel Simeon and Crane.
Jewels of Java owner Karel Simeon said it was an honor to field a Jewels of Java team to play in the memorial golf tournament, which raised more than $2,000 in Dykeman’s memory. The funds are used to offer scholarships to students in Dykeman’s hometown of Central Square, just north of Jewels of Java’s headquarters.
